Operating system: linux(all)
PHP version: 4.2.3
PHP Bug Type: Feature/Change Request
Bug description: php references - error reporting
function &reference_return($val) {
global $ref_array;
return $ref_array[$val];
}
<b>$ref = &reference_return(0);</b>
is it possible to get an E_NOTICE if people forget to type the "&" before
the function which should return references?
